This comprehensive catalog serves as a centralized source for critical industrial automation components, supporting a wide spectrum of legacy and current control architectures. The inventory spans multiple functional layers, including Distributed Control Systems (DCS), Programmable Logic Controllers (PLC), and Turbine Supervisory Instrumentation (TSI). It features specialized hardware ranging from vibration monitoring modules and rack-based controllers to high-density I/O interfaces, power supply units, and communication gateways.

Mastering Modern Industrial Joystick Controls in Heavy Automation

Industrial joysticks play a pivotal role in human-machine interaction across heavy material handling and mobile hydraulics. These tactile controllers translate complex operator movements into precise electrical signals for PLCs, motion controllers, and DCS networks. Consequently, selecting and installing the right joystick architecture ensures operator safety, reduces fatigue, and optimizes equipment performance.

Navigating Industrial Automation Failures: Types, Causes, and Mitigation Strategies

Modern manufacturing relies heavily on automated control systems to maximize throughput and maintain product quality. However, unplanned downtime in industrial automation can cost facility operators thousands of dollars per hour. Understanding how programmable logic controllers (PLCs), distributed control systems (DCS), and field instrumentation fail empowers engineering teams to implement robust preventive maintenance strategies.

Essential Motion Control Commands: A Practical Guide for Engineers

Automation engineers often rely on precise position and speed control to drive modern factory machinery. Modern industrial systems, such as Programmable Logic Controllers (PLCs) and Distributed Control Systems (DCS), depend heavily on standardized motion instructions. Mastering these commands ensures operational safety, protects mechanical components, and optimizes cycle times across production lines.
